Senior Superintendent
C. Herman Construction is a general contracting company specializing in multifamily and mixed-use development. They are seeking an experienced Senior Superintendent responsible for managing onsite construction operations, ensuring project schedules are met, and mentoring junior staff while fostering a safe and collaborative environment.
Responsibilities
Lead overall on-site construction operations from groundbreaking to project closeout, ensuring safety, quality, and efficiency at every stage
Develop, maintain, and drive the master construction schedule, ensuring milestones and final completion dates are achieved or exceeded
Provide direct leadership and mentorship to Superintendents, Assistant Superintendents, and field staff, cultivating accountability and professional growth
Coordinate sequencing and logistics for podium and structured parking construction, ensuring smooth integration with multifamily components
Monitor subcontractor performance to ensure compliance with budgets, schedules, codes, and quality standards
Oversee safety programs and enforce compliance, ensuring a safe working environment for all project personnel
Maintain proactive communication with Director of Construction, General Superintendent, Project Managers, architects, engineers, and inspectors to resolve issues and keep work progressing
Implement and manage quality control plans and maintain accurate documentation of project progression
Foster strong relationships with clients, design partners, and subcontractors to maintain project alignment
Ensure a secure, clean, and organized job site, representing the company’s commitment to professionalism and excellence
